This wasn’t shot on Apple’s $30,000+ immersive camera systems or a Hollywood pipeline. But with high bitrate exports, careful stabilization, depth-focused framing, and lots of obsessive tweaking, I think this gets close enough visually to be a good free alternative.
For people with the newer M5 Vision Pro models, YouTube now supports full 8K playback in the headset, so you can watch this directly in the YouTube app at 4320s quality for maximum detail.
People with the M2 Vision Pro version can also watch it for free in full quality on DeoVR, which currently handles high-resolution VR playback really well.
